Transaction 3453ab7a573032fd3c85e229f05e12d8839b4a1eaa61c88eb682dc4cee15c99e

1 Input
2 Outputs
  • 3453ab7a573032fd3c85e229f05e12d8839b4a1eaa61c88eb682dc4cee15c99e:0
  • value  495356408
    address  35ATzRGoba71VeFoaWu7ybRgj5CmiHbCW6
  • 3453ab7a573032fd3c85e229f05e12d8839b4a1eaa61c88eb682dc4cee15c99e:1
  • value  4947169
    address  1FfJyyerQDyx2HQwnZLT5ARnDwN9CjbLF3